Wyvern Academy has made significant progress since its last inspection, moving from a position of requiring improvement to being rated as good overall. The school fosters a positive and inclusive environment where pupils feel happy and safe, and staff have developed strong relationships with students. The leadership team has successfully implemented a broad and ambitious curriculum that caters to the diverse needs of its students, ensuring that all pupils, including those with special educational needs and/or disabilities, are well-supported and engaged in their learning.

Strengths

  • Pupils are happy, safe, and well-supported.
  • Strong and respectful relationships between staff and pupils.
  • Broad and ambitious curriculum that allows for pupil choice.
  • Effective support for pupils with special educational needs and/or disabilities.
  • Consistent behavior expectations with most pupils meeting them.
  • Rich extra-curricular opportunities promoting personal development.

Areas for Improvement

  • Inconsistency in curriculum delivery across some classes.
  • Tasks sometimes do not consider pupils' starting points.
  • Pupils lack a secure understanding of other faiths and religions.

Attainment 8 Score

Attaimenment 8 is a measure of a pupil's average grade across a set of 8 subjects. The 8 subjects which make up Attainment 8 are:

  • English
  • Maths
  • 3 subjects from qualifications that count towards the English Baccalaureate (EBacc), like sciences, language and history
  • 3 more GCSE qualifications (including EBacc subjects) or technical awards from a list approved by the Department for Education

Each grade a pupil gets is assigned a point score from 9 (the highest) to 1 (the lowest). These scores are added up, with English and maths counted twice.
